Legions of jazz trumpeters consider the Martin Committee a vital addition to any serious horn collection. Dizzy Gillespie's first upward-bent bell was on a Committee. Miles Davis played one all his life. Chris Botti has compared his acquisition of an early one to finding a rare Jaguar or Porsche. Chet Baker, Art Farmer, Maynard Ferguson, Al Hirt, "Blue" Mitchell, Red Rodney, Clark Terry ... all those cats wielded a Committee for all or part of their career.
